Storage Tips

Proper storage of Famotidine is crucial to maintain its effectiveness and safety. Here are some important storage tips to keep in mind:

1. Store in a cool, dry place: Keep Famotidine away from heat, moisture, and direct sunlight. Avoid storing it in the bathroom or near any sources of moisture.
2. Keep in the original container: Store Famotidine in its original packaging to protect it from light and humidity. Avoid transferring it to other containers.
3. Close the container tightly: Make sure the container is tightly closed after each use to prevent air and moisture from getting inside.
4. Keep out of reach of children: Store Famotidine in a place that is out of reach of children and pets to prevent accidental ingestion.
5. Check the expiration date: Always check the expiration date on the packaging and discard any expired medication properly.

Temperature Guidelines:

Famotidine should be stored at room temperature between 68-77°F (20-25°C).

Avoid storing famotidine in areas that are too hot, cold, humid, or exposed to direct sunlight.

Do not freeze famotidine as extreme temperatures can affect its effectiveness.

Keep famotidine away from heat sources such as radiators or stoves.

Proper temperature control ensures the efficacy of famotidine when used.

Light Exposure Recommendations

It is crucial to store Famotidine in a container that protects it from light exposure. Light can degrade the medication and reduce its effectiveness over time. To ensure maximum potency, store Famotidine in a dark, opaque container that blocks out light. Avoid storing it in clear or translucent containers that allow light to penetrate and potentially harm the medication.
